Easiest thing to do is get a test light and start checking the wires in the area you wanting to make the splice. There are many different wires in many different locations that are active in the acc. position.

the black wire with the pink stripe that connects to teh back of the stereo works for accessories. It's only "live" when the key is in the acc. pos.

Jimb...I tried the add-a-circuit on Saturday to add power for my radar detector...worked like a charm. I added into slot 5 and the only catch was that I needed to trim the inside of the fuse cover in order for it to snap back on. Just a little trimming and it worked like a charm. Much safer and neater than pushing wire under a fuse. Good Luck...
